Rocket League has also had a bump looks a lot less jaggy now.

It's getting another update in a month or two with some big technical improvements, with the option to choose between performance and quality modes

https://www.rocketleague.com/news/rocket-league-roadmap-spring-2018/

  • Switch Performance & Visual Quality Updates
    • Performance Mode - 900p (Docked) / 720p (Handheld) @ 60 FPS with infrequent dynamic resolution scaling
    • Quality Mode - Native 1080p (Docked) / 720p (Handheld) @ 30 FPS with added visual effects
